Skip to content

Commit ccade4d

Browse files
committed
test(controlplane): make invalid contract fixture fail on value not unknown field
With unknown-field tolerance (DiscardUnknown) in contract parsing, a contract whose only problem was an unknown field is now valid. Update the invalid YAML fixture to fail validation for a real reason (invalid material name) so TestIdentifyAndValidateRawContract keeps asserting a validation error. Assisted-by: Claude Code Signed-off-by: Jose I. Paris <jiparis@chainloop.dev> Chainloop-Trace-Sessions: ec69dde4-acef-48c8-b319-76774e77c877
1 parent 891c1c9 commit ccade4d

1 file changed

Lines changed: 3 additions & 1 deletion

File tree

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,4 @@
11
schemaVersion: v1
2-
notAContract: true
2+
materials:
3+
- type: CONTAINER_IMAGE
4+
name: INVALID_NAME

0 commit comments

Comments
 (0)